Is lighter fluid flammable after it dries?

When lighter fluid evaporates, it disperses into the surrounding atmosphere. The gas produced by the evaporated lighter fluid is still flammable and can cause explosive chemical reactions to occur in the air and with any of the lighter fluid still left in a liquid form.

Can a lighter explode if you drop it?

It’s unlikely to explode, but it could break and spill fuel all around. If there were sparks or flame present, the spilled fuel might ignite (but not explode).

Can lighter fluid evaporate?

Lighter fluid will evaporate even when the lighter is not used, so be sure to always keep the lid closed and it’s a good idea to refuel before each outing. Take caution to do the following away from any source of fire or flame.

What do you do if you spill lighter fluid?

Upholstery

  1. Mix one tablespoon of liquid hand dishwashing detergent with two cups of cool water.
  2. Using a clean white cloth, sponge the stain with the detergent solution.
  3. Blot until the liquid is absorbed.
  4. Repeat Steps 2 and 3 until the stain disappears.
  5. Sponge with cold water and blot dry.

What happens if you accidentally inhale butane?

Butane is a gas used in lighters and as a propellant in aerosol sprays. National Poisons Centre toxicologist Leo Schep says it can cause drowsiness, suffocation, heart palpitations, temporary memory loss or death when inhaled, typically by “sudden sniffing syndrome”.

What is the hottest color for fire?

white-blue
When all flame colors combine, the color is white-blue which is the hottest. Most fires are the result of a chemical reaction between a fuel and oxygen called combustion.
